Understanding The Crucial Role of Sump Pump Installation
A sump pump is a submersible electrical device designed to move water away from your home’s foundation. When installed correctly, it acts as a vigilant guardian, activating automatically when groundwater levels rise and pumping the water out and away from your property. This preventative measure safeguards your home against the pervasive and costly issues associated with water intrusion, such as mold growth, structural damage to foundations, and the deterioration of interior finishes. How Expert Sump Pump Installation Works In Blue Springs
The process of a professional sump pump installation in Blue Springs is a systematic approach aimed at ensuring optimal performance and longevity. Whether you have a ranch-style home common in many Blue Springs subdivisions or a more historic property, the installation typically involves several key steps:
- Site Assessment: A qualified plumber will first assess your basement or crawl space to determine the best location for the sump pit and pump. This involves evaluating the natural slope of your yard and identifying any existing drainage issues.
- Sump Pit Excavation: A hole is dug in the lowest section of your basement or crawl space to create the sump pit. This pit serves as the collection point for accumulating water.
- Sump Pit Installation: A sturdy sump pit, often made of plastic or concrete, is placed in the excavated hole. Perforations in some pits allow water to seep in from the surrounding soil.
- Pump Placement: The sump pump, a submersible unit designed to operate efficiently in water, is then carefully set into the sump pit.
- Discharge Pipe Installation: A crucial step involves connecting the pump to a discharge pipe that will carry the water away from your home’s foundation. This pipe is typically routed from the sump pit, through the foundation wall or basement wall, and then directed downhill to a safe distance away from your property, a storm drain, or a culvert. Considerations are made for freezing temperatures common in Missouri winters to prevent blockages.
- Electrical Connection: The sump pump is connected to a dedicated electrical circuit with a properly functioning GFCI outlet, ensuring safe and reliable operation.
- Testing: Once installed, the pump is thoroughly tested to ensure it activates correctly, pumps water effectively, and the discharge line is clear.
Professionals often utilize durable materials such as PVC piping for discharge lines, robust submersible pumps with float switches, and reliable check valves to prevent backflow. The type of pump recommended may vary based on the volume of water expected and the specific needs of your Blue Springs property.

Beyond installation, what other sump pump services are commonly needed?
Beyond initial installation, homeowners often require regular sump pump maintenance, battery backup system installation for power outages, sump pump repair if the unit malfunctions, and inspection of the discharge lines to ensure they remain clear and functional, especially after harsh weather events.
